  • Publication number: 20150095056
    Abstract: Methods, systems, computer storage media, and graphical user interfaces for population health management are disclosed. The population health management system may allow for cross-continuum tracking and subsequent interactions with transactional systems, providers, and/or patients. The population health management system may include utilizing clinically relevant algorithms to populate registries to enable healthcare providers to better facilitate care for a population of patients. The population health management system may consolidate and provide comprehensive condition-specific and/or patient situation specific information that is accessible and updatable across venues. The population health management system may create cross venue antibiograms based on medications information and susceptibility results which can be filtered for selected demographics.

  • Publication number: 20140200915
    Abstract: Readmission risks of patients admitted to a healthcare facility are determined using a generic readmission risk algorithm. The readmission risk assessment of patients may be based on portions of a patient's profile and may be performed before, during, and after their index admission. Based on the readmission risk assessment of patients, those patients that are at a greater risk for readmission may be identified. A readmission prevention worklist may be provided that identifies those patients and facilitates managing the risk of readmission for those patients.

  • Publication number: 20140180699
    Abstract: Systems, methods, and user interfaces for providing dynamic risk stratification for clinical decision support are provided. Selections of patient types are received for patients. Assessments to utilize are determined in accordance with the patient types. The assessments are displayed to facilitate first clinicians assessing risk factors and contraindications for the patients. Information associated with the patients is received. Second clinicians may be alerted if risk factors for the patients are identified and the assessments have not been completed. Pharmacologic and/or mechanical prophylaxis is recommended and overall risk levels associated with the patients are indicated.
